Round 3 of the 2024 WHOOP UCI MTB World Cup is heading to Nove Mesto na Morave this weekend, Racing begins on Friday with the U23 XCC & ends with the Elite Male race on Sunday.
About Nove Mesto na Morave
Nove Mesto na Morave has hosted the World Cup since 2011, the town which is in the Vysočina Region of the Czech Republic.
The Course
The course has had some sections refreshed, including the Rock n Roll section which has had a complete overhaul for this year, they have also added in two new jumps near to the start and finish.
XCC
Distance: 1.01km Climbing: 25m
XCO
Distance: 3.79km Climbing: 137m

Riders
We currently know that Evie Richards will not take to the start line after suffering a server concussion, Mathiu Van der Poel has also confirmed he will not take part in any MTB races this year. Thomas Pidcock will also take to the start line like usual for him in Nove Mesto na Morave.
